Chaahat is a deeply emotional collection of nazms and ghazals that arise from the silent corners of the heart. It is where longing meets truth, where unspoken words find rhythm, and where love transforms into reflection.
Each piece carries fragments of memory, desire, loss, and hope - woven together with simplicity and sincerity. These poems do not try to impress; they try to connect. They speak softly, yet they linger long after the last line.
In Chaahat, love is not merely romance - it is remembrance, absence, presence, and the quiet space where someone still remains.
This book is for anyone who has ever loved silently, felt deeply, and searched for meaning in emotions that refuse to fade.
